A scarce K.P.M. and Indian Police Medal for Distinguished Conduct group of six awarded to Inspector General C. J. Minister, Bengal Police, late Yorkshire Regiment and Royal Air Force, who was twice wounded during the Great War

King’s Police Medal, G.VI.R., 1st issue, for Distinguished Service (C. J. Minister, I.P. Addl. I.G. of Police, Bengal); Indian Police Medal, G.VI.R., for Distinguished Conduct (C. J. Minister, I.P., Bengal); British War and Victory Medals (Lieut. C. J. Minister); Jubilee 1935; Coronation 1937, good very fine (6) £600-800

Cycril John Minister was born on 31 October 1897 and was educated at the University of London. He served during the Great War with the 4th Battalion, Yorkshire Regiment on the Western Front from 24 July 1916, and was wounded in September of that year. Returning to the front in March 1917, he was wounded for a second time in April 1917. Promoted Lieutenant on 1 July 1917, he was seconded for service with the Royal Air Force on 26 October 1918. He joined the Indian Police Service as an Assistant Superintendent on 15 March 1921.
